Understanding Your Skin Type
determineing Your Skin’s Needs:
Determining your skin type is the cornerstone of any achievementful beauty routine. Knowing whether your skin is oily, dry, combination, or sensitive directly influences product choices. Oily skin tends to produce excessive sebum, requiring products that control oil production. Dry skin, on the other hand, needs moisturizing agents to replenish moisture. Combination skin presents a mixture of both concerns, needing products that target specific areas. Sensitivity requires extra care, choosing gentle products without harsh chemicals. Properly determineing your skin type helps you tailor your routine effectively. Take note that these types may change over time based on environmental factors or changes in hormone levels, so maintaining a healthy diet and managing stress can help in that respect. Consider consulting a dermatologist for a precise assessment if you are unsure of your skin type or if you’re facing persistent skin issues.
Creating a Personalized Routine Based on Your Skin Type:
A personalized routine acknowledges the individual nuances of your skin’s specific needs and sensitivities. Once you’ve determined your skin type, you can create a routine to address the specific concerns it presents. For oily skin, incorporating salicylic acid into your routine can help in maintaining a balanced oil-production. Dry skin benefits from incorporating rich moisturizers and hydrating serums. Combination skin requires products that can balance hydration and oil-control. The key is to carefully select products that are targeted toward each specific part of your skin’s needs.
Choosing Effective Products
selecting High-Quality Products:
Not all beauty products are created equal. Choosing high-quality products is crucial for a lasting beauty routine. Ingredients matter – look for products with natural and gentle ingredients that nourish your skin and don’t lead to irritation. Avoid products with harsh chemicals, artificial colors, or fragrances. Understanding the ingredients in your products is a great way to avoid potential sensitivities. Start with a few key products and gradually expand your collection. This way, you can avoid getting overwhelmed and also be able to test for any allergies.
Prioritizing Ingredients:
Prioritize products with natural ingredients. Natural ingredients generally trigger less reaction and often are known to be better for the skin. These products may be more expensive than traditional ones, however, they are worth the investment if they suit your skin’s needs. Ingredients like hyaluronic acid, vitamin C, and retinol have potent skin-boosting properties when chosen correctly. study varied types of ingredients and the impact they have on your skin type, whether it be to address fine lines, wrinkles, acne, blemishes or dark spots. If you have allergies, you might want to be extra cautious on these ingredients.
